  1. The Isley Brothers ist eine amerikanische Soul-/Funk-Band, die in den 1950er Jahren von den drei Brüdern O’Kelly, Rudolph und Ronald Isley als Gospelchor in Cincinnati, Ohio gegründet wurde. Mit dem vierten Bruder Vernon bildeten sie ein Quartett, bis dieser bei einem Autounfall ums Leben kam.
